Impact of the entomopathogenic fungus Verticillium lecanii on development of an aphid parasitoid, Aphidius colemani [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of Invertebrate Pathology, 2005
The parasitoid Aphidius colemani developed normally (approximately 90% adult emergence) when its cotton aphid (Aphis gossypii) host was treated with Verticillum lecanii conidia 5 or 7 days after parasitization. Fungus exposure 1 day before or up to 3 days after parasitization, however, reduced A. colemani emergence from 0 to 10%.

Oviposition behaviour of the polyphagous aphid parasitoid Aphidius colemani Viereck (Hymenoptera: Aphidiidae)

Agriculture, Ecosystems & Environment, 1995
Abstract A population of Aphidius colemani Viereck imported from La Reunion successfully parasitized Aphis gossypii Glover, Myzus persicae Sulzer, Rhopalosiphum padi L., and Toxoptera aurantii Boyer de Fonscolombe in the laboratory. The parasitoid stung, but did not complete development in five other common aphid species.
